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
702579633 2399449 357426991 54 7860110
742812 1896
742812 1896
104244511 945018812 865728 466
All about undefined
Interested in learning more?
742812 1896
104244511 945018812 865728 466
See more
28 3820470842
84 82 96006 6160376
See more
9673329 57173262992 544094078
8546 251 544447
See more